分享

flask基础学习一

 戈安御凝 2021-01-31

源码:

from flask import Flask,redirect,url_for


app = Flask(__name__)


@app.route("/home")

def home():

return"Hello! This is the main page <h1>HELLO<h1/>"


@app.route("/<name>")

def user(name):

return f"Hello {name}!"


@app.route('/admin')

def admin():

return redirect(url_for("home"))


if __name__ == "__main__":

app.run(debug=True)


学习来源:https://www.bilibili.com/video/BV1Qv4y1Z7jD

run flask项目:在flask项目的路径下进入terminal,python 该flask项目。

或者vscode中Ctrl+option+N 运行该项目。

或者sublime text中command+B 运行该项目。


debug=True 设置后需要重启terminal


redirect 重定向


url_for()的作用:

(1)给指定的函数构造 URL。

(2)访问静态文件(CSS / JavaScript 等)。 只要在你的包中或是模块的所在目录中创建一个名为 static 的文件夹,在应用中使用 /static 即可访问。

    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多